"After Becoming a Girl, I Accidentally Provoked a Yandere" is a work full of modernity and drama. The author, Xiao Xiao Zi Su Ye, uses her unique perspective and rich imagination to construct a bizarre and fascinating story world. Plot: The main line of the story revolves around the transformation of the protagonist Jiang Xuge and his relationship with Song Qianning. Jiang Xuge accidentally turned into a girl while completing the task. This transformation not only brought huge changes to her life, but also made her relationship with Song Qianning more complicated and profound. Song Qianning's yandere character adds a lot of tension and excitement to the story, and her paranoia and possessiveness make readers curious about the relationship between the two. Characters: Jiang Xuge's character development is very engaging. She gradually transforms from a task worker into an individual with her own emotions and desires. Song Qianning's role is more complicated. Her yandere character makes people love and hate her, but her deep love for Jiang Xuge is touching. Style: The author's writing style is direct and powerful, and is able to capture the reader's emotions well. The dialogues and inner monologues in the story are very realistic, allowing people to delve into the inner world of the characters.
